AmgelEscape - Amgel Easy Room Escape 77 is another point and click escape game developed by Amgel Escape. In this game, you are locked in a room and you have to try to escape the room by finding items and solving puzzles. Show your best escaping skills to escape from the room. Can you able to escape from the room successfully? Good luck and have fun!
Angry Birds Racers Jigsaw
Lucky Beauty Perfect Dressup Running 3D
Blocky Taxy ZigZag
Real Jeep Parking Sim
Bird Trap
Charlotte Valley
Two Wall
Extreme ATV Quad Racer
Goose Game Multiplayer
Police Survival Racing
Island Puzzle
Flappy Hungry Bird
Idle Diner Restaurant Game
My Dream Hospital
Hoov vs Doov Game
Traffic Ride Skibidi Toilet
Kido Gen
Ice cream master Game
Rescue The Pigeon
Pizza Maker Cooking
Galactic Pixel Storm
Crazy Monster Trucks Difference
Battle Cubes 3D
Steveman
Coma
Minicraft Adventure
Fall Race 3d - Fun & Run 3D Game
Grand theft Blockworld
Little Panda World Recipes
Heart Match Master